About the Bihar Panchayat Secretary Exam
There is no separate standalone Bihar Panchayat Secretary written exam. Panchayat Secretary (Panchayat Sachiv) posts are filled through the BSSC Intermediate (10+2) Level Combined Competitive Examination along with other Group-C posts such as LDC and Revenue Employee. Selection typically includes Prelims, Mains, and document verification (plus skill/typing tests where a post requires them). Prelims is a single CBT of 150 objective questions for 600 marks in 2 hours 15 minutes, with +4 for correct and −1 for incorrect answers. Syllabus centres on General Studies (including Constitution and Panchayati Raj), General Science & Mathematics, and Mental Ability; Hindi language is a major Mains Paper 1 focus.

Bihar Panchayat Secretary Exam Content Outline
General Studies
Current affairs, awards, sports, Indian history and freedom struggle, geography, economy, Constitution and polity, Panchayati Raj, community development, and Bihar-specific GK including the state’s role in the national movement.
General Science and Mathematics
Everyday physics, chemistry, and biology at matric level, plus arithmetic, algebra, geometry, mensuration, and data interpretation basics.
Mental Ability Test
Comprehension-based reasoning, coding-decoding, number/letter series, analogies, Venn diagrams, syllogism, seating arrangement, and problem-solving.
General Hindi / Awareness (Mains Paper 1)
Hindi grammar (sandhi, samas, vilom, paryayvachi), vocabulary, idioms, and comprehension — critical for Mains qualification.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is there a separate exam only for Bihar Panchayat Secretary?
No. Panchayat Secretary posts are generally filled through the BSSC Inter Level (Intermediate / 10+2) Combined Competitive Examination. Candidates choose or are allotted posts based on merit, preferences, and eligibility after clearing the common exam stages.
What is the BSSC Inter Level Prelims pattern?
Prelims has 150 objective questions for 600 marks in 2 hours 15 minutes: General Studies (50), General Science and Mathematics (50), and Mental Ability (50). Each correct answer gives 4 marks and each wrong answer deducts 1 mark.
What educational qualification is required?
Candidates must have passed Intermediate (10+2) or an equivalent examination from a recognized board. Always verify any post-specific extra requirements in the latest BSSC notification.
What is the application fee?
For the recent BSSC Inter Level (Advt. 02/23) cycle, the application fee has been ₹100 for all categories, payable online.
What are the minimum qualifying marks?
Category-wise minimum qualifying marks are typically UR 40%, Backward Class 36.5%, Extremely Backward Class 34%, and SC/ST/Women/PwD 32%. Final appointment depends on Mains performance and vacancy cut-offs.
Does the syllabus include Hindi and Panchayati Raj?
Yes. Panchayati Raj and the Indian Constitution are part of General Studies in Prelims. Hindi language is a major component of Mains Paper 1 (General Awareness / Hindi).
